How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 19190?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 19190 Studio Apartments | $1,739 | $647 | $4,742 |
| 19190 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,305 | $812 | $7,803 |
| 19190 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,303 | $970 | $18,899 |
| 19190 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,771 | $700 | $21,501 |
| 19190 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,048 | $585 | $24,995 |
| 19190 5 Bedroom Apartments | $3,308 | $2,000 | $5,700 |
| 19190 6 Bedroom Apartments | $2,316 | $600 | $3,090 |
